Medical professionals normally use a topical anesthetic cream in advance to assist numb the area being treated. It has few negative effects other than momentary redness and swelling post-treatment. Microneedling typically has a much shorter recovery time compared to the lasers or chemical peels that are also made use of to assist resurface the skin and improve its texture.
These lotions can help start the procedure of collagen manufacturing. Your doctor cleanses your skin and uses a numbing cream or ointment, such as lidocaine gel. They do this concerning thirty minutes to 45 minutes prior to your treatment, so the ointment has time to work. Next off, your medical care company utilizes a hand-held roller or an electrical tool to make the injuries in your skin.

Your medical care service provider rolls it gradually and delicately across your skin. If they use the electrical tool, needles pulse backwards and forwards to pierce your skin. They can alter the size of the needles on the electrical device. Longer needles go deeper right into your skin, which could be required if you have deep marks or cavities from acne.
Your skin may be red and inflamed for up to 5 days. An ice pack can help in reducing irritation and discomfort. Most individuals can use make-up the day after the treatment, however you must stay out of the sunlight up until your skin heals.

The pinpricks from microneedling cause slight injury to the skin, and the skin responds by making new collagen-rich cells. By urging the skin to make brand-new cells, added collagen may help make the skin firmer.

Roughly 45 mins to before the treatment, the medical professional usually applies a topical anesthetic to the therapy location. This will numb the skin throughout the microneedling procedure, which takes approximately thirty minutes. During the treatment, a physician makes small pricks under the skin utilizing a pen-like tool with tiny, sanitized needles.
The doctor usually relocates the device evenly throughout your skin so that the recently invigorated skin will be even. They might finish your session by using a growth serum or calming therapy.
You may observe skin inflammation and redness within the first of the procedure. It's best to let your skin recover before applying makeup.

After microneedling, your skin functions rather quickly to revitalize brand-new cells. You might see outcomes within a couple of weeks. You'll likely need several sessions or complementary therapies to preserve the outcomes. The doctor will certainly collaborate with you to establish a strategy based upon your individual goals.
Unlike specialist microneedling, most home derma rollers do not puncture the skin to layers deep enough to draw blood. While this could seem a less agonizing choice, you may not achieve the same outcomes, according to the AAD (36 needle microneedling). The slits made during professional microneedling are created to cause skin renewal. While you might be able to buy medical-grade tools online that a lot more deeply pass through the skin, it's finest to have this therapy done by an expert in a regulated environment.
People usually make use of microneedling to treat marks, hyperpigmentation, and stretch marks. Outcomes might vary based on the extent of the skin concern, its area, and the treatment plan used.

Disadvantages: You might need several sessions to keep your results and the treatment is likely not covered by insurance coverage. Microneedling and Botox have different objectives. Microneedling can treat scars, hyperpigmentation, and large pores by boosting the skin's manufacturing of collagen. Botox injections protect against certain muscle mass from contracting and creating wrinkles on the skin.

Microneedling is a clinical treatment that uses tiny needles to pierce the skin. Skin doctors use it to decrease: Acne scars Dark spots Huge poresMelasmaSagging skinScars due to surgery or an injury Stretch marksUneven skin texture and toneWrinkles and great linesMicroneedling is minimally intrusive and safe for all complexion. It functions by promoting your body to make collagen.
This can lead to much less noticeable marks and wrinkles, and more even skin tone and appearance. Products sold for at-home microneedling and microneedling performed in a non-medical spa aren't indicated to pierce the skin.
